The Campaign Overview
The Kickstarter campaign for Neutronium: Parallel Wars launches in Q3-Q4 2026. Its goal is straightforward: fund the first production run of a game that is already designed, playtested through 12+ sessions across multiple player groups, and approximately 85-90% complete in terms of component design and rulebook finalization. This is not a campaign asking for faith in a concept. It is a campaign asking for the manufacturing budget to turn a near-complete prototype into a physical product.
The game supports 2 to 6 players and plays in 30 to 60 minutes depending on player count and universe cycle depth. It is rated for ages 7 and up — the core mechanics are accessible to younger players, while the strategic depth across 13 universe cycles satisfies experienced 4X board game audiences. The game has been tested with players ranging from first-time board gamers to experienced hobby players, and the rulebook is written to accommodate both.
The Kickstarter goal funds the production run, component manufacturing, packaging, and fulfillment logistics. The campaign will not include stretch goals that expand the scope of the base game in ways that require additional design time — the design is done. Stretch goals fund production quality upgrades and language editions, not new mechanics or new cards. This distinction matters: it means backers are getting the game they see described here, not a version of the game that depends on unfinished work being completed after funding.

Pledge Tiers
Three pledge tiers are available. All include the complete base game. The higher tiers add upgraded components and exclusive items — they do not unlock additional gameplay content. The base game is the full game at every tier.
The complete Neutronium: Parallel Wars game with all standard components. Everything needed to play the full 2-6 player game across all 13 universe cycles. Manufactured to standard hobby board game quality. This is the game.
- Complete component set as listed above
- Full rulebook (final print edition)
- Standard quality hero miniatures
- Standard Nn token set
All Base Game contents plus upgraded component materials. The Collector's Edition is for players who want the tactile experience of the game to match its 25-year design investment. All upgrades are cosmetic quality improvements — no gameplay differences from the Base Game.
- Upgraded hero miniatures with detailed sculpts and separate bases
- Foil-finish treatment on all 44 Artifact cards
- Linen-embossed territory hex tiles
- Metallic-ink Nn token face printing
- Collector's Edition numbered box art variant
All Collector's Edition contents plus items documenting the game's history. Limited to a small print run. The Designer's Edition is for players and collectors who want to own the complete story of how Neutronium: Parallel Wars came to exist, not just the game itself.
- Signed copy (signed by designer Vladislav Tsaran)
- Development Notes booklet: 25-year design history, rejected mechanics, rulebook evolution
- Numbered prototype-era component set (select cards and tokens from playtest iterations)
- Certificate of edition number
- Exclusive Discord role: "Designer's Circle"
Stretch Goals
Stretch goals unlock when the campaign surpasses its base funding target. Every planned stretch goal is a production quality upgrade or an expansion of language and platform access — not new game mechanics that require additional design time. What we fund beyond the base goal goes into the physical object, not into changing what the game is.
- Language Packs: Russian, German, FrenchFull rulebook and card face translations for RU, DE, and FR. Each language unlocks as a separate goal tier. Translated editions ship simultaneously with the English edition.
- Metal Neutronium TokensReplace the standard Nn token set with die-cast metal coins in the same denominations. Upgrades all tiers automatically when this goal is reached.
- Digital Companion AppA companion app providing a rules reference, session timer, universe cycle tracker, and Nn calculation assistant. Available for iOS and Android. No gameplay is moved to the app — it supplements, not replaces, the physical experience.
- Expansion: Universe 14 (Solo Mode)A solo mode expansion adding Universe 14 — a single-player scenario that takes place after the 13-universe cycle concludes. Includes a new board overlay, solo opponent mechanics, and narrative resolution content for the game's lore. This expansion is fully designed and requires only manufacturing funding to produce.
